Output 58e0c2c27d8599061207df6d3a2901164628333104ebb4851dfae0dc9ac2f2b6:1

value
1890840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f85148f34d18fec29fbfebfe713f6e0789fe69 OP_EQUAL
address
32RA8HnmxN6xudnRzrRQQ37XjVm66uhpjq
transaction
58e0c2c27d8599061207df6d3a2901164628333104ebb4851dfae0dc9ac2f2b6
spent
true